Sorry for being late to the party. I have used Paul Joppa's triode load equation for years and it gives a pretty good estimate for the transformer load. The equation is V/I - 2.38*rp = Load
So for your GM70 we have V = 1100volts, I = 90mA and rp = 1850ohms thus 1100/0.09 - 2.38*1850 = 7819 ohms. An 8k transformer would be the closest and the Monolith is certainly a good choice.
